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 Lemon
1-2 garlic buds
2 cups water
1 T sweetener, optional

Directions:
Directions:
Using a peeler take off only the yellow part of the rind of the lemon, leaving the white part with it's vitamin C complex. Cut lemon in half with the seeds and throw in the blender. Put peelings in a ziploc bag in the freezer (use one inch when you make a fruit smoothie for a nice lemon taste). Add garlic and water and blend well. The strong lemon and garlic flavors mellow each other out for an easily drinkable therapeutic treat. Sweeten to taste.
